PROUD VALLEY - the most important Welsh film of its time? - Review
Cymru was once a common setting for American and British movies. THE PROUD VALLEY was released in 1940 from Ealing Studios and written specifically for its star, the American communist Paul Robeson. Here I take a look at the star, his cultural and political leanings and how they contributed to a film which poses questions for modern Welsh internationalists.
